<b>2. Model sentence</b>
She is short and thin
She has long blond hair
<i>*Form:</i>
S+ be+ adj
S+ have/has+ adj+ hair
+ Use : to describe body build and hair.
+ Meaning : T asks Ss to translate into
vietnamese.
+ Pronunciation : T checks the intonation.
This person is short and thin.
She has long black hair
